How they compare
Sierra Leone currently reports 0.165 % change on previous year against -0.1554 % change on previous year in Brazil, a difference of 0.3204 % change on previous year.
That makes Sierra Leone's figure about 1.1 times Brazil's.
The two have swapped places 20 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Brazil ahead.
Brazil ranks 147th and Sierra Leone ranks 144th of 190 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Brazil averaged higher in 2 and Sierra Leone in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brazil | Sierra Leone |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1.01 % change on previous year | -2.55 % change on previous year | 3.56 % change on previous year | Brazil |
| 2000s | 2.47 % change on previous year | 2.09 % change on previous year | 0.3835 % change on previous year | Brazil |
| 2010s | -0.259 % change on previous year | 4.31 % change on previous year | 4.57 % change on previous year | Sierra Leone |
| 2020s | 0.2329 % change on previous year | 1.67 % change on previous year | 1.43 % change on previous year | Sierra Leone |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Manufacturing, value added (constant LCU).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
